【Swift】カスタムセルを利用する際の注意点【Swift勉強会】

Swift

こんにちは、エンジニアのnecomimiです。

今回は、私がカスタムセルを利用した際に直面した問題点について紹介します。同じ問題で悩んでいる方はぜひ参考にしていってください。

エラー文

私がカスタムセルを利用した際、以下のようなエラーが発生しました。

見た感じstrongプロパティをweakプロパティでオーバーライドできないとのことでした。ただ、imageViewをこれより前に定義した覚えはなく、結局ネットで解決策を探しました。

解決策

様々なサイトを調べたところ、TableViewCellではすでにstrongでimageViewという変数が定義されているということがわかりました。なので、変数名をimageView以外にすることにより、今回のエラーは解消されました。

さいごに

今回はカスタムセルを使用する際に発生するエラーについて紹介しました。エラーが発生するとメンタル的にもきついと思うので、この記事を参考にスムーズな開発をしていただければと思います。

ちなみに、先日ついにToDoアプリが完成したので、ぜひインストールして感想をいただけたら幸いです!

怠惰な人のための自己管理アプリ 〜もう絶対に忘れない〜 App - App Store
Download 怠惰な人のための自己管理アプリ 〜もう絶対に忘れない〜 by Yudai Kase on the App Store. See screenshots, ratings and reviews, user tips, and more apps like 怠惰な人のための自己管理アプリ 〜もう絶対に…

コメント

タイトルとURLをコピーしました